20 Core 2.1GHz Xeon ProLiant DL360 Servers

The 20 Core 2.1GHz Xeon ProLiant DL360 Servers category represents a high-density enterprise rack server solution designed for data centers, virtualization environments, cloud computing platforms, and mission-critical business applications. Built on Intel Xeon multi-core architecture and integrated within the ProLiant DL360 chassis design, this server class delivers a balance of performance, scalability, energy efficiency, and enterprise-grade reliability for modern IT infrastructures.

Core Architecture of 20 Core Xeon DL360 Servers

At the heart of this server category is the Intel Xeon processor featuring 20 physical cores operating at 2.1GHz base frequency. This configuration is optimized for parallel processing, allowing simultaneous execution of multiple workloads across enterprise applications.

Multi-Threaded Enterprise Performance

With support for hyper-threading, each core can handle multiple threads, effectively increasing processing capacity for virtualization, databases, and distributed computing environments.

Balanced Frequency and Core Density

The 2.1GHz clock speed provides a balance between computational throughput and power efficiency, making it suitable for workloads that require consistent processing rather than peak single-thread performance.

Workload Optimization Efficiency

This architecture is particularly effective for cloud hosting, containerized applications, and backend processing systems where sustained performance is critical.

HPE ProLiant DL360 Server Platform Design

The ProLiant DL360 series utilizes a compact 1U rack-mounted chassis, allowing high-density deployment within enterprise data centers.

Space-Efficient Data Center Deployment

Organizations can maximize rack space efficiency while deploying multiple high-performance servers within a limited physical footprint.

Enterprise-Grade Build Quality

The DL360 platform is engineered with durable components, redundant systems support, and advanced cooling mechanisms to ensure long-term operational stability.

Continuous 24/7 Operation

These servers are designed for uninterrupted workloads, making them ideal for mission-critical applications requiring high uptime guarantees.

Memory and Storage Architecture

20 Core Xeon ProLiant DL360 servers support large-scale memory configurations, enabling high-performance computing and virtualization workloads.

ECC Registered Memory Integration

Error-Correcting Code (ECC) memory ensures data integrity by detecting and correcting memory errors, reducing system crashes and data corruption risks.

Multi-Channel Memory Bandwidth

These servers utilize multi-channel memory architectures that significantly increase data transfer rates between CPU and RAM.

Improved Virtual Machine Density

Higher memory bandwidth allows more virtual machines to run simultaneously without performance bottlenecks.

Enterprise Storage Options

DL360 servers support multiple storage configurations including SATA, SAS, and NVMe drives for high-speed and redundant data storage.

RAID Data Protection

Integrated RAID controllers ensure data redundancy, performance optimization, and protection against drive failures.

Networking and Connectivity Features

ProLiant DL360 servers support Gigabit and multi-Gigabit Ethernet networking for fast data communication across enterprise environments.

Low-Latency Data Transfer

Optimized network controllers ensure minimal latency in data exchange between servers, storage systems, and clients.

Advanced Network Expansion

PCIe slots allow installation of high-speed network interface cards including 10GbE, 25GbE, and 40GbE adapters.

Scalable Data Center Networking

Enterprises can expand network capacity based on workload demands and traffic growth requirements.

Server Management and Remote Administration

HPE ProLiant DL360 servers include iLO technology for remote server management, monitoring, and troubleshooting.

Remote Access Capabilities

IT administrators can manage server health, perform firmware updates, and troubleshoot issues without physical access to the hardware.

Automated System Monitoring

Real-time monitoring tools track CPU usage, memory consumption, storage health, and network performance.

Proactive Issue Detection

Early detection of hardware failures helps reduce downtime and improve system reliability.

Security Features in DL360 Servers

Security starts at the firmware level with hardware-based root of trust mechanisms ensuring system integrity from boot-up.

Secure Boot Protection

Only verified and signed firmware is allowed to load, preventing unauthorized system modifications.

Data Encryption and Access Control

Enterprise servers support encryption technologies for data at rest and in transit.

Role-Based Security Policies

Administrators can define user roles and permissions to restrict access to sensitive systems and data.
